Hologram

While you are in the reception area of the building, you can find the interactive hologram. The hologram is regularly updated with 3D scanned artifacts by our VR team, where you can view, manipulate, and know more about the artifact. This all can be done with your bare hands without grabbing any physical controller and see everything in the hologram space.

Interactive projector

At the mezzanine floor, you will find a student’s lab which is a space equipped with desks, computers and facility for lectures and labs. The student lab is equipped with interactive projector to help the instructor to give the best learning experience to the students. The interactive projector can present slides – using Wi-Fi direct connection – where the instructor can add live notes to it using the interactive pen. It can be used as white board or can combine displaying material with white board capabilities to enrich the experience. Once the lecture is finished, the instructor can save everything to a flash drive or send it to their students email directly.

3D scanner

When you have a broken part and want a replacement or you want to manufacture some parts that will be assembled with others, you need to either have a detailed drawings or you do 3D scanning. 3D scanner is very useful to do reverse engineering to manufacture or print broken parts without having the original drawings. The PDL in the Acoustics Building is equipped with a 3D scanner in addition to the handheld scanner in the VR lab.

Samsung Flip chart

The digital flipchart provides smooth and familiar pen-to-paper-like writing in a variety of colors, styles, and widths. Up to 4 people can write simultaneously and erase drawings with a finger or palm swipe. you can quickly and easily select, move, crop, capture and edit any images. Each image can also be merged to the digital note roll. Finally, instantly distribute meeting notes via email, network, thumb drive or even printouts if wanted.

Auditorium System

The Auditorium is equipped with surrounding 3D sound system, high-end projector with motorized screen, and microphones. All systems are connected to controller unit that enable the lecturer to start all systems using one click on iPad. The system automatically opens the projector, motorized screen, and open the speakers with options to connect via 8 mm plug, handheld wireless microphone, or wireless nick microphone. From the same system lecturer can control the light system in the auditorium and select turn off/on parts of the auditorium.

Pressurized Air & Water Network in Labs

All measurement labs in DSDC building are supplied by pressurized air and water. The air network is connected to compressor on the rooftop that maintain the pressure level in the whole network and make it ready to be used anytime it is needed. A drain system is also installed near to water supply to drain the excess water.

High Speed Internet

The Acoustics Building (DSDC) is supplied with high-speed internet using two different sources: microwave link and optical fiber line. These two sources ensure continuous and reliable internet access with enough bandwidth to serve different activities in the building.
